Indian Institute of Technology Madras (IIT Madras) will admit the second batch of students to its BTech in AI programme for the upcoming academic year of 2025-26. Aimed at making students global leaders in the field of Artificial Intelligence, B.Tech in Artificial Intelligence and Data Analytics has been crafted to equip them with key skills and knowledge.

The undergraduate program puts the focus on both the fundamentals of AI and how to build applications. It also offers a strong industry connection through its internships and UG Research Opportunities, as per a statement by IIT-M.

“Students will have career opportunities in diverse areas ranging from fundamental research in global tech companies to applied sectors such as manufacturing and healthcare,” read a statement from the NIRF #1-ranked Institute in the country.

In addition to this, the programme will provide academic flexibility through a wide range of electives from within and outside the department, which include Speech and Language Technology, Computer Vision, Applications in Control and Detection and Time-Series Analysis.

“The Program aims to cultivate expertise in diverse aspects of AI and data analytics, offering a panoramic view of its applications across industries,” the varsity said.

Students who have cleared the JEE (Advanced) can choose this program in the upcoming JOSSA Counselling. The intake capacity has been set at 50. The course code is 412L: Artificial Intelligence and Data Analytics.

The statement noted that there will be a strong emphasis on Math Fundamentals, Data Science /AI/ML Foundations, Application Development and Responsible Design, “besides a distinct interdisciplinary flavour.”

The B.Tech in AI course is being offered through the Wadhwani School of Data Science and AI, which aims to be among the “top AI-focused schools worldwide and also advise the Government and policymakers on Data Science and AI-related policy areas.”

From foundational courses in linear algebra and calculus to specialised modules in machine learning, deep learning, generative AI, foundation models and reinforcement learning, students are equipped with a robust toolkit to tackle the varied challenges in this discipline.

The program will let students take courses from one of the two core baskets – comprising traditional applications and system-oriented applications – of Data Science and AI.

Additionally, there are also courses on introducing the principles of responsible design in AI. Focusing on application to real-world problems and Fair and Responsible AI, the program teaches how to apply data analytics and AI techniques to tackle real-world challenges across diverse domains. It fosters innovation and impact, and embraces the principles of fairness and responsibility in AI development, while ensuring ethical and equitable deployment of technology.

Prof. V. Kamakoti, the director of IIT Madras, said, “AI and Data Analytics is an emerging area. This BTech course has a carefully evolved curriculum that is perfectly aligned with both the industry and research community needs.”

“Many interesting challenges are in front of us and I am sure students shall immensely benefit by pursuing this course and shape their prosperous future,” he added.
